Emergency loans are designed to provide rapid capital when unexpected circumstances threaten your business operations. You need this type of financing when you face sudden revenue disruptions, natural disasters, or other crises that require an immediate infusion of cash to stay afloat. These loans are intended for short-term stabilization to cover essential costs like payroll, rent, or utilities. Acting quickly is crucial when applying, as these programs often have specific windows of availability and require clear proof of financial hardship.

An SBA loan means the loan you obtain from a lender is partially guaranteed by the U.S. Small Business Administration. This guarantee reduces lender risk, often resulting in more favorable terms and easier access to capital for small businesses in Raleigh looking to grow their operations.

The easiest SBA loan to qualify for often depends on your business's financial profile and the specific loan program. SBA Express loans are known for their streamlined application and faster approval times. Connecting with a pro can help identify the most accessible SBA loan option for your Raleigh business.
Eligibility for an SBA loan generally requires your business to be a for-profit entity operating in the U.S. and meeting SBA size standards. You'll need to demonstrate a need for the funds and have a good credit history. The pros can help you assess if your Raleigh business meets these criteria.
